There's A Manual E39 BMW 540i With Just 5.5k Miles For Sale

A super low-mileage 1998 BMW 540i outfitted with the sought after six-speed manual transmission in Bellevue, Washington with a $26,950 asking price.

The BMW 5-Series has long been one of the German marque's quint-essential cars and it is perhaps the E39-generation model that sports the most timeless design. In fact, while this car is 22 years old, it still has quite a lot of appeal to it thanks to the simple and uncomplicated design that has aged very gracefully.



While the 540i is no M5 of the day, it came close enough for most drivers as it was the next most powerful 5-Series variant sporting a naturally-aspirated 4.4-liter V8 engine that produced 282 hp back in the day. While that's 112 hp less than the E39 M5, it's still a respectable amount of power to be sent through the rear wheels via a six-speed stick shift. At the time, C&D quoted a 5.4 second run for the 0-60 mph (96 km/h) for the manual model, which even today, sounds fast enough to be enjoyable.

The listing reveals that this is a Canadian-spec car that was sold new at Adelaide Motors in Toronto back in early 1998. The most recent owner purchased and imported it into the United States in November 2019 and it currently has 5,583 miles (8,986 km) under its belt.



Despite the vehicle's age, it comes complete with a number of luxurious features that could fool you into thinking it is much newer than it actually is. For example, there are 12-way power-adjustable bucket seats with 3 memory settings for the driver, an auto-dimming rear mirror, a 10-speaker audio system, automatic dual-zone climate control, and cruise control. It also gets the sports package.
